Originally Posted by 00T/AWS6
I was just more curious about what all was in the engine, intake/tb?? What size cam or heads are on it??
Still an LS1/LS6 block as far as I know, factory heads (243 castings ported by Cartek I believe) and an LS1 intake manifold (I thought it was an LS6 manifold but I saw Sonnie once post that it was actually an LS1?) and a factory 75-78mm throttle body (I assume ported/polished).
Not sure of the cam size but I'm sure it's Cartek's standard hydraulic blower cam.
All things considered it's a pretty basic motor, nothing too exotic.
